Etika dan Keamanan dalam Penggunaan Kode HTML

4
(277 votes)

Kode HTML merupakan bahasa pemrograman yang mendasari struktur dan konten website. Penggunaan kode HTML yang tepat dan bertanggung jawab sangat penting untuk memastikan website yang aman, mudah diakses, dan ramah pengguna. Namun, penggunaan kode HTML juga memiliki implikasi etika dan keamanan yang perlu diperhatikan. Artikel ini akan membahas etika dan keamanan dalam penggunaan kode HTML, serta bagaimana pengguna dapat mempraktikkan prinsip-prinsip etika dan keamanan dalam pengembangan website.

Etika dalam Penggunaan Kode HTML

Etika dalam penggunaan kode HTML berkaitan dengan bagaimana pengguna kode HTML bertanggung jawab dalam membangun website yang adil, inklusif, dan mudah diakses oleh semua orang. Prinsip-prinsip etika dalam penggunaan kode HTML meliputi:

* Aksesibilitas: Kode HTML harus dirancang agar website dapat diakses oleh semua orang, termasuk pengguna dengan disabilitas. Hal ini dapat dilakukan dengan menggunakan atribut ARIA, menyediakan teks alternatif untuk gambar, dan memastikan bahwa website dapat dinavigasi dengan keyboard.

* Keadilan: Kode HTML harus digunakan untuk membangun website yang adil dan tidak diskriminatif. Hal ini berarti menghindari penggunaan kode HTML yang dapat menyebabkan bias atau diskriminasi terhadap kelompok tertentu.

* Privasi: Kode HTML harus digunakan untuk melindungi privasi pengguna. Hal ini berarti menghindari penggunaan kode HTML yang dapat mengumpulkan data pengguna tanpa persetujuan mereka.

* Transparansi: Kode HTML harus digunakan dengan transparan. Hal ini berarti bahwa pengguna harus dapat memahami bagaimana kode HTML digunakan dan bagaimana data mereka digunakan.

Keamanan dalam Penggunaan Kode HTML

Keamanan dalam penggunaan kode HTML berkaitan dengan bagaimana pengguna kode HTML melindungi website dari serangan dan ancaman keamanan. Prinsip-prinsip keamanan dalam penggunaan kode HTML meliputi:

* Validasi Input: Kode HTML harus memvalidasi input pengguna untuk mencegah serangan injeksi kode. Hal ini dapat dilakukan dengan menggunakan fungsi escape dan sanitize untuk membersihkan input pengguna sebelum diproses.

* Sanitasi Output: Kode HTML harus membersihkan output untuk mencegah serangan cross-site scripting (XSS). Hal ini dapat dilakukan dengan menggunakan fungsi escape dan sanitize untuk membersihkan output sebelum ditampilkan di browser.

* Penggunaan Library dan Framework: Kode HTML harus menggunakan library dan framework yang aman dan teruji. Hal ini dapat membantu mengurangi risiko serangan keamanan.

* Pembaruan Keamanan: Kode HTML harus diperbarui secara berkala untuk mengatasi kerentanan keamanan baru. Hal ini dapat dilakukan dengan menggunakan sistem manajemen versi dan dengan mengikuti rekomendasi keamanan dari vendor.

Praktik Etika dan Keamanan dalam Pengembangan Website

Berikut adalah beberapa praktik etika dan keamanan yang dapat diterapkan dalam pengembangan website:

* Gunakan atribut ARIA untuk meningkatkan aksesibilitas website.

* Hindari penggunaan kode HTML yang dapat menyebabkan bias atau diskriminasi.

* Dapatkan persetujuan pengguna sebelum mengumpulkan data mereka.

* Gunakan fungsi escape dan sanitize untuk memvalidasi input dan membersihkan output.

* Gunakan library dan framework yang aman dan teruji.

* Perbarui kode HTML secara berkala untuk mengatasi kerentanan keamanan baru.

Kesimpulan

Penggunaan kode HTML yang bertanggung jawab sangat penting untuk memastikan website yang aman, mudah diakses, dan ramah pengguna. Dengan mempraktikkan prinsip-prinsip etika dan keamanan dalam pengembangan website, pengguna dapat membangun website yang adil, inklusif, dan aman bagi semua orang.